Output 703fb32d8c79e20de60fa6cd3e8ed4fbd72da976fa7fd01eb53de9ef947676eb:1

value
19015437
script pubkey
OP_0 OP_PUSHBYTES_20 dd3c464d9247db664edda2c859cec4a4d49c0510
address
bc1qm57yvnvjgldkvnka5ty9nnky5n2fcpgs3f847p
transaction
703fb32d8c79e20de60fa6cd3e8ed4fbd72da976fa7fd01eb53de9ef947676eb
confirmations
191919
spent
true